Fibula: the slender bone of the lower leg

The fibula is the thinner, lateral bone of the lower leg in humans and many tetrapods. It provides muscle attachments, lateral stability to the ankle and knee, and has clinical importance in fractures and grafting.

Overview

The fibula is one of the two long bones that form the lower leg in humans and many other four‑limbed vertebrates. It runs parallel to the larger, weight‑bearing tibia and lies on the lateral side of the leg. In comparative anatomy the fibula also appears in the hind limb of tetrapods and varies in size and shape across groups.

Structure and articulations

The fibula is typically described with a head at its proximal end, a long shaft, and a prominent distal projection called the lateral malleolus. Proximally it articulates with the tibia at the proximal tibiofibular joint; distally it helps form the ankle by contributing the lateral malleolus that grips the talus. The bone does not directly articulate with the femur or the knee joint, though it provides attachment sites for structures near the knee.

Function and muscle attachments

The fibula is not the main weight‑bearing bone of the leg—that role belongs to the tibia—but it plays important roles in stabilizing the leg and ankle and serving as an attachment site for muscles. Several calf and foot muscles originate from or attach to the fibula, including the fibularis (peroneus) muscles and parts of the soleus and tibialis muscles. The head of the fibula is a site where the tendon of the biceps femoris and ligaments attach, contributing to lateral stability.

Development and evolution

During human growth the fibula ossifies from centers in the shaft and ends and matures through childhood into adolescence. In evolutionary terms the fibula appears throughout tetrapod lineages but shows modification: in some birds and cursorial mammals it is reduced or fused, whereas in many reptiles and amphibians it retains a form similar to the tibia.

Clinical significance

Fractures of the fibula are common, often in combination with ankle injuries. Because the common fibular (peroneal) nerve wraps around the fibular neck, trauma there can affect nerve function and produce sensory changes or weakness of dorsiflexion. The fibula is also frequently used in reconstructive surgery as a donor for bone grafts because of its length and relative expendability.

Distinctions and notable facts

  • The fibula is slender and lateral, while the tibia is broad and medial.
  • It contributes the lateral malleolus that stabilizes the ankle joint.
  • In comparative anatomy the bone’s form varies; see resources on limb bones in tetrapods and the human lower leg.
  • Above the leg are the femur and knee complex; the fibula supports but does not directly bear the knee joint.
